Recognizing Refractive Surgery Treatments
When thinking about refractive surgical treatment procedures, it's essential to recognize how they can reshape your vision.
These techniques concentrate on dealing with usual vision concerns like nearsightedness, hyperopia, and astigmatism. You'll generally run into methods such as LASIK, PRK, and SMILE, each using advanced technology to change the shape of your cornea.
LASIK includes developing a flap in the cornea, while PRK eliminates the outer layer totally. SMILE, on the other hand, makes use of a minimally invasive approach.
Prior to devoting, you'll undergo a complete analysis to determine the best choice for your eyes. Recognizing these procedures provides you the expertise to make an educated decision, guaranteeing you pick the right course in the direction of clearer vision tailored to your special requirements.

Recuperation and Aftercare for Refractive Surgical Treatment
After going through refractive surgical treatment, you'll need to concentrate on a proper recuperation and aftercare routine to ensure the most effective possible results.
Right after the treatment, you may experience some discomfort, yet it is very important to follow your doctor's guidelines. Usage prescribed eye drops to stop infection and lower swelling. Stay clear of massaging your eyes and use safety glasses as recommended.
Relaxing your eyes is important; limit display time and bright lights for the first few days. Go to all follow-up visits to check your recovery process.
